Section 119 Administration of Criminal Justice Law (ACJL) Lagos

Section 119 Administration of Criminal Justice Law of Lagos State, as amended in 2021, is about Admission to bail after its refusal. It provides as follows:

A Judge may, if he thinks fit, admit any person charged before a Magistrate Court to bail although the Court before whom the charge is made has not thought it fit to do so.
